Cloud computing is defined as a type of computing that depends on sharing computing resources rather than having local servers or personal devices to handle applications.

In cloud computing, the word cloud is used as a symbol for "the Internet," so the phrase cloud computing means "a type of Internet-based computing," where different services — such as servers, storage and applications — are delivered to an organization's computers and devices through the Internet.

Cloud takes a variety of forms, combining technologies, solutions, and consumption models to help you create and leverage an agile, efficient, and cost-effective infrastructure for delivering SLA-based services. Some organizations are building its own private cloud, while others use public cloud options for less critical applications and data, and potentially lower cost.
